LANCOR HOLDINGS LTD. (LANCORHOL) — Working Capital to Net Assets Ratio
LANCOR HOLDINGS LTD. (LANCORHOL) has a Working Capital to Net Assets ratio of -37.0% as of March 2026. Working capital of Rs-886.36 Million (current assets of Rs332.31 Million minus current liabilities of Rs1.22 Billion) is measured against net assets of Rs2.39 Billion. Annual Working Capital to Net Assets for LANCOR HOLDINGS LTD. (2020–2026)
The table below presents the year-by-year Working Capital to Net Assets ratio for LANCOR HOLDINGS LTD. from 2020 to 2026, covering 7 annual filings. Each row shows current assets, current liabilities, working capital, net assets, the ratio, and the change in percentage points compared to the prior year. | Year | WC/NA Ratio | Working Capital (INR) | Net Assets | Current Assets | Current Liabilities | Change (pp)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2026 | -37.0% | Rs-886.36 Million | Rs2.39 Billion | Rs332.31 Million | Rs1.22 Billion | ▼ -144.3 pp |
| 2025 | 107.3% | Rs2.10 Billion | Rs1.96 Billion | Rs3.39 Billion | Rs1.30 Billion | ▲ +39.2 pp |
| 2024 | 68.1% | Rs933.21 Million | Rs1.37 Billion | Rs2.42 Billion | Rs1.48 Billion | ▼ -10.9 pp |
| 2023 | 78.9% | Rs1.03 Billion | Rs1.31 Billion | Rs2.26 Billion | Rs1.23 Billion | ▼ -23.0 pp |
| 2022 | 102.0% | Rs1.34 Billion | Rs1.31 Billion | Rs2.51 Billion | Rs1.17 Billion | ▲ +3.5 pp |
| 2021 | 98.4% | Rs1.46 Billion | Rs1.48 Billion | Rs2.99 Billion | Rs1.53 Billion | ▲ +132.5 pp |
| 2020 | -34.0% | Rs-952.05 Million | Rs2.80 Billion | Rs970.00K | Rs953.02 Million | — |
